27.08.2015 - Oil Prices Fall on Less Gas Demand, Growing Glut
Oil prices resumed falling after U.S. stockpile data showed a surprise drop in gasoline demand and record supplies of crude oil and petroleum products. The data reaffirmed growing concerns that the global oil market will remain awash in crude through the end of the year. Oil prices have plunged in recent weeks on worries that the global glut of crude that halved oil prices in 2014 has yet to shrink.
